Forum: Platinen Coplanar waveguide in Altium ?


von Martin (Gast)


Lesenswert?

Hallo,

weiß jemand wie man in Altium Coplanar Waveguides machen kann? Also 
ausrechnen ist nicht das Problem - aber dann das verlegen der 
Leiterbahn. Muss ich da den Umweg über irgendwelche DRC-Regeln gehen ?

Merci

von und nun (Gast)


Lesenswert?

Ja, ueber DRC regeln.

von Georg (Gast)


Lesenswert?

Martin schrieb:
> weiß jemand wie man in Altium Coplanar Waveguides machen kann?

Einen Coplanar Waveguide gibt es als solchen eigentlich nicht, das ist 
eine einfache Leiterbahn mit einer GND-Fläche drum herum, und die wird 
wie jede andere GND-Fläche aufgefüllt, also gilt die Angabe, welcher 
Abstand zwischen Leiterbahn und GND einzuhalten ist. Meistens ist das 
sowieso der allgemeine GND.

Braucht man eine speziellen Abstand, anders als sonst auf der 
Leiterplatte, muss man für diese Waveguides eine extra Klasse anlegen 
und eine DRC-Regel gegen GND.

Georg

von Patrick R. (ptrck)


Lesenswert?

Hallo zusammen!

Ich möchte den Thread nochmal ausgraben, da ich wie der Threadersteller 
ebenfalls eine Coplanar-Leitung in Altium erstellen möchte.

Habe bisher versucht 2 unterschiedliche Clearance-Rules zum GND-Polygon 
zu verwenden. Eine allgemeine Rule habe ich die dafür sorgt, dass vom 
GND-Polygon ausgehend zu allen Objekten 1mm Platz gelassen wird (zum 
konfortablen Handlöten später...). Die funktioniert auch einwandfrei.

Dann habe ich noch eine 2. Clearance-Rule erstellt:
Unter "First Object Matches": (die Coplanar Nets/ Leitungen)
(InNet('NetC10_1') AND InNet('NetC10_2') AND InNet('NetC11_1') AND 
InNet('NetC11_2') AND InNet('NetC18_1') AND InNet('NetC18_2'))

Unter "Second Object Matches":
InNamedPolygon('GND_Plane_Top')
Und dann unten in der Reihe "Poly" den Wert 0.14 eingestellt.

Habe die Priorität schon gewechselt zwischen den beiden Rules aber es 
bleibt immer nur die 1mm-Rule aktiv. Wäre schön wenn mir jemand genauer 
erklären könnte wie ich das mit DRC-Rules erledige. Oben wurden 
NetClasses vorgeschlagen, aber da hab ich gar keine Ahnung von wie man 
die erstellt.

Besten Dank!

Grüße
Patrick

von Georg (Gast)


Lesenswert?

Patrick Rublevsky schrieb:
> Unter "First Object Matches": (die Coplanar Nets/ Leitungen)
> (InNet('NetC10_1') AND InNet('NetC10_2')

Ich kenne mich damit ja nicht aus, da ich Altium nicht benutze, aber 
bist du sicher dass es AND heissen muss und nicht OR? Die AND Bedingung 
wird doch nie erfüllt.

Georg

von Patrick R. (ptrck)


Lesenswert?

Danke Georg.

Da hast du vermutlich recht. Hatte ich einen Gedankenfehler drin. Leider 
klappt es auch mit OR nicht. Gleiche Resultate.

von Purzel H. (hacky)


Lesenswert?

Ich eroeffne eine Clearance regel fuer das Netz, resp fuer diese 
Netzgruppe.

von Patrick R. (ptrck)


Lesenswert?

Genau das habe ich doch auch versucht, oder nicht? Könntest du ein 
bisschen genauer erklären wie du das machst? Nutze Altium noch nicht so 
lange...

von Purzel H. (hacky)


Lesenswert?

Im PCB Editor. Design Rules - Clearance - New rule.
1. Full Query = inNet('GND')
2. Full Query = inNetClass('coplanar')

set distance...

Vorgsaengig im Schema, diese Netclass zuweisen. Mit
1. Place - Directives - Net Class
2. Anwenden auf die Netze

von Patrick R. (ptrck)


Lesenswert?

Wunderbar! Besten Dank, hat jetzt geklappt!

Grüße
Patrick

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.